Explode

S3 E1 Explode

While Space Ghost trades witty repartee (read: the usual insipid silliness) with Terry Jones, Lokar tries to lure Moltar away from the show and onto his own talk program with promises of lots of fancy fringe benefits.

Première diffusion : 2 février 1996

$20.01

S3 E2 $20.01

Space Ghost is fed up with Moltar and Zorak, and decides to replace them with his super computer named Mo 2000.

Première diffusion : 9 février 1996

Sharrock

S3 E5 Sharrock

The show takes a while to start, with the title music heavily extended, Thurston Moore joins the show as Ghost Planet comes under attack, forcing Space Ghost to bombard the audience with another extended musical number before finally revealing that the entire show was simply a dedication to the music of the late Sonny Sharrock.

Première diffusion : 1 mars 1996

Freak Show

S3 E7 Freak Show

Space Ghost's interview is interrupted by a pirate channel created by one of the show's more...dedicated fans (aka a geek who knows everything about the show and lives with his mother). Despite Moltar's efforts, the geek is determined to have his demands met before he will relinquish control.

Première diffusion : 22 mai 1996

Cookout

S3 E13 Cookout

This one starts out with arguments about Beefaroni, and Space Ghost elects the Council of Doom and Brak to judge a cooking contest. Zorak wants all of the bones for a soup, and they talk about cooking Space Ghost. One chef makes duck tacos, and another plays gymnastics with a dead chicken. Space Ghosts says it's a tie, and then blows up the Council of Doom, and finally Brak gets shot. He cries, and wants his lawyer. This is a double episode.

Première diffusion : 11 décembre 1996
